review_stars 07/10/2017 - Anne Rupert
Think this place, once called the Depot has another name now. Always made a point of stopping there. Had a vegetable plate on menu. Also baked small bread in clay flower pots. It was NOT the Whistle stop but next door on West side of RR tracks. Took many photos while standing on porch, must dig them out to see name. Hope it is still under same ownership. Very quaint. Great fried green tomatoes. It was once a train station.

review_stars 09/05/2010 - J
My husband called to make sure they were open and they answered with another name: Tony York's. They took our reservation. I wish they had been totally booked. We ordered Hot Browns for $12.95 each and my husband requested a side salad. I think they charged about $10 for that. Good flavor, but the ham in my dish was cold in the middle, very chewy and had several large chunks of grizzle. The cherry tomatoes on the side were good. C. liked the salad a lot, but wasn't expecting the added cost. We ordered dessert without looking at prices. C. got chocolate cake and I got 7 layer coconut, both which took a longer than average time to serve (probably because they were frozen. Cost, $6 and $8 respectively! The total cost was about $50 for the two of us. Foo-foo atmosphere. No flower-pot bread (or any bread basket). You only get exactly what you ask for and get charged Ala carte. What a waste of money!

review_stars 10/23/2008 - CALLYCAT
Visiting your area, we were referred to your restaurant, as a "local favorite." We were anticipating good 'ol country cooking - and were REALLY disappointed at your attempt at Fine Dining. The restaurant was nestled in a quaint little antique town, but failed at trying to be Big Shots. We were very shocked at the prices, even for your entrees that could be considered country fare. In todays enconomy, you'd better stick to hometown cooking, at hometown prices. We would NOT recommend this place to anyone.
